About Fora
Fora is the modern travel agency, empowering the next generation of entrepreneurs to build thriving travel advisory businesses. We're modernizing the $100B+ travel industry with AI woven through every part of the advisor's workflow, plus global supplier relationships, personalized training, and a vibrant community, all in one place. That's what lets advisors build businesses that scale, while their taste and service create trips no algorithm alone could plan. At the heart of it all is our mission: to help the next generation of travel entrepreneurs turn their love for travel into a fulfilling career, whether full-time or part-time.
We're mission-driven and obsessed with our customers, and we believe humans and AI are both essential: the best work here comes from people and technology at their best, together. That's not just a philosophy about our product, it's how we build our team. Everyone at Fora gets hands-on with frontier AI tooling as part of the job. At Fora, you'll learn to be AI-fluent, with real experience applying AI to solve problems day to day, wherever you sit in the company.
Founded in 2021, Fora has grown to a team of 250+ full-time employees based in downtown New York City. In 2026, we closed a $60 million Series D led by Forerunner and Tactile Ventures, with continued backing from Thrive Capital, Insight Partners, and Heartcore Capital. We've been named a LinkedIn Top Startup (2024), one of Fast Company's Most Innovative Companies (2023 and 2025), and one of TIME's 100 Most Influential Companies (2026).

About the Role
- We’re seeking a General Manager to launch and lead a new agency within Fora Agency Lab, initially focused on the adventure travel vertical. This is an opportunity to build a niche travel business from the ground up, powered by Fora’s AI enabled platform, supplier relationships, training, and infrastructure, while helping prove a model that Fora can replicate across future travel verticals.
- The General Manager will own the agency’s strategy, brand, client growth, operations, and overall business performance. As the agency scales, this person will recruit and develop a team of independent contractors to grow the business and extend its reach.
- This role is designed for an entrepreneurial operator who is energized by building from scratch, comfortable owning outcomes end to end, and excited to use technology as a core part of how they work. While adventure travel is the initial focus, we are open to candidates with deep expertise and authentic passion for another travel niche.
- This is a full time role, with a remote option considered.
